.. Respondents Prayer: Criminal Original Petition is filed under Section 482 of Cr.P.C., to direct the respondents to register a case on the basis of the petitioner's complaint dated 11.04.2016 and investigate the same in accordance with law.

For Petitioner :Mr.C.Prakasam For Respondents :Mr.C.Emalias Addl. Public Prosecutor

O R D E R

The petitioner has come forward with this petition seeking a direction to the respondents to register a case pertaining to the petitioner's complaint dated 11.04.2016.

2.The learned counsel for the petitioner submitted that the petitioner has lodged a complaint before the respondents on 02.04.2016. But the respondents have not shown any interest to enquire the matter and register the case. Hence, the petitioner has come forward with this petition for the above stated relief. 3.At this juncture, the learned Additional Public Prosecutor, on instructions, would submit that on the basis of the complaint lodged by the petitioner, enquiry is pending in C.S.R.No.127 of 2016.

4.Considering the rival submissions made on both sides, on the basis of the complaint lodged by the petitioner, as enquiry is pending in C.S.R.No.127 of 2016, the second respondent is directed to expedite the enquiry and follow the dictum laid down in Lalitha Kumari vs. Govt. of U.P & others [2013 (4) Crimes 243 (SC) and register a case, if any cognizable offence is made out.

5. The Criminal Original Petition is disposed of with the above direction.
